What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a bus driver assistant?

To thrive as a Bus Driver Assistant, you need a basic understanding of safety procedures, strong observational skills,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with communication devices, student management protocols, and emergency equipment is typically required. Patience, clear communication, and a calm demeanor are vital soft skills for supporting students and assisting the driver. These skills and qualities are important to ensure student safety, smooth transportation operations, and effective response to emergencies.

What qualifications do you need to be a bus driver assistant?

To become a bus driver assistant,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, a valid driver's license, and good communication skills. Some positions may require background checks and training on safety procedures and customer service. Additional certifications, such as first aid, can be beneficial but are not always mandatory.

What is a bus driver assistant?

Bus Driver Assistants, also known as bus monitors or aides, are individuals who support the bus driver in ensuring the safety and well-being of passengers, especially children, during school bus routes or special transportation services. Their duties often include helping passengers board and exit the bus, maintaining order, assisting students with special needs, and communicating with drivers and school staff about any concerns. They play a vital role in creating a secure and positive transportation environment.

What is the difference between Bus Driver Assistant vs Bus Driver?

AspectBus Driver AssistantBus Driver
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some regions may require a commercial driver’s license (CDL) or permitHigh school diploma or equivalent; CDL with passenger endorsement often required
Work EnvironmentAssist bus drivers on routes, often in school or transit settingsOperate buses, transport passengers safely on scheduled routes
Employer & IndustrySchool districts, transit agencies, private transportation companiesPublic transit agencies, school districts, private transportation providers

The main difference between a Bus Driver Assistant and a Bus Driver is that the assistant supports the driver by helping with passenger management and safety, while the bus driver is responsible for operating the vehicle and navigating routes. Both roles often require similar certifications, but the bus driver holds the primary responsibility for driving and safety.

What are some common challenges a bus driver assistant might face during their daily routes?

Bus Driver Assistants often encounter challenges such as managing student behavior, ensuring passenger safety during entry and exit, and communicating effectively with both the driver and students. They must remain calm and attentive, especially during busy or noisy routes, and be prepared to handle emergencies or unexpected situations. Building rapport with students while enforcing bus rules is key to maintaining a safe and positive environment.
